HVAC Repair Services: What’s Included and Why It Matters

When a home stops holding temperature, comfort is the first casualty, and costs are a close second. Most HVAC problems start small, then grow teeth. A capacitor gets weak, a drain clogs, a furnace sensor drifts out of calibration, and suddenly the house is humid and the electric bill climbs. Good HVAC repair services do more than swap parts. They diagnose, stabilize, and extend the life of complex systems that quietly run every hour of the day. Knowing what a thorough air conditioning service or heating and cooling repair should include helps you get the right work, at the right time, for a fair price.

What “repair” really covers

HVAC means heating, ventilation, and air conditioning. In practice, repair techs see mostly air conditioning repair during hot months and furnace or heat pump issues when the temperature drops. A complete HVAC system repair visit is part detective work, part triage, and part preventative care. It usually includes three phases: inquiry, testing, and remedy.

The inquiry matters. A seasoned tech asks specific questions. When did the symptoms start? Is the problem constant or intermittent? Any recent power surges? Was the filter changed recently? Those answers shape a hypothesis. For example, short cycling after a storm often points to a control board or thermostat issue, while a gradual loss of cooling suggests airflow restrictions, a dirty outdoor coil, or low refrigerant charge from a slow leak.

Testing is where experience shows. Pros carry multimeters, manometers, thermometers, gauge sets, and, these days, Bluetooth probes that capture pressures and temperatures accurately. On a cooling call, I expect to see superheat and subcool readings, not guesses. On a heat call, a tech should measure temperature rise, static pressure across the blower, and combustion analysis for gas furnaces when applicable. Without these numbers, you are paying for hunches.

Remedy is not just replacing whatever failed. It includes stabilizing the system so the same failure does not come right back. Clearing a drain without treating algae or flushing the pan is a half-fix. Replacing a failed capacitor without inspecting the contactor and checking amperage on the compressor and fan motor leaves a time bomb.

What a thorough air conditioning repair visit looks like

Air conditioner repair visits vary by problem, but a complete approach follows a rhythm. The tech verifies airflow first. A clean filter, unobstructed return grilles, and a blower wheel that is not caked with dust transform performance. Static pressure readings tell you if the duct system is choking the equipment. I have seen brand-new condensers strapped to undersized returns that could barely move air, leading to repeated freeze-ups and nuisance trips.

Electrical checks come next. Inspect disconnects, tighten lugs, look for heat discoloration, and test capacitors under load. The cheap, run-of-the-mill capacitor is a top failure item, but it rarely fails alone. A pitted contactor can weld, drawing high amperage and cooking motors. A good tech scopes these together and explains the chain.

Then comes the refrigeration circuit. After confirming fans and blowers are running to spec, pressures and temperatures are measured to calculate superheat and subcool. These numbers reveal charge health and metering device performance. If charge is low, the ethical step is to find the leak. Tiny leaks often hide in Schrader cores, rub-outs in line sets, or on coils. Dye and electronic sniffers help, but sometimes soap bubbles and patience do better. Topping off with refrigerant without leak checking is a common shortcut. It is also how compressors die early and bills balloon. Where repairs are possible and warranted, fix the leak. Where they are not, discuss options honestly.

Drainage and condensation control round out cooling work. A clogged primary drain can overflow into walls and ceilings. Clearing the trap, vacuuming the line at the exterior, and adding a cleanout cap is standard. Installing or testing a float switch can save a ceiling. In humid markets, I often recommend treating the drain with a small algaecide tablet monthly during peak season. It is a dollar habit that prevents hundred-dollar messes.

Heating problems follow their own logic

Furnace and heat pump issues have patterns too. On gas furnaces, flame sensors get a film and stop reading, leading to short cycles. Cleaning them properly, not just scuffing them raw, restores function. Pressure switches trip when condensate drains partially clog or when combustion air is restricted. That means clearing the drain, verifying slope, and checking terminations outside. A cracked ignitor will ohm out differently than it looks, a detail that catches rushed techs.

On heat pumps, defrost cycles can mask problems. If the outdoor fan motor is slowing or seizing, high head pressure follows. Low refrigerant on heat pumps shows up as poor heat output and long cycles, then frost. Measure, don’t guess. Electric strip heaters are straightforward to diagnose with amperage measurements per stage. When strips come on too often, it points to control logic, sensor placement, or an undersized or compromised heat pump.

For gas appliances, a combustion analysis offers data on oxygen, carbon monoxide, and efficiency factors. Draft checks ensure flue gases leave the building. I have walked into homes with backdrafting water heaters that no one had measured for years, all while the furnace was assumed to be the problem. An HVAC maintenance service that includes combustion checks pays back in safety before comfort.

What you should expect in writing

Scope and transparency separate reliable HVAC repair services from the rest. Before work begins, you should see a written estimate that lists findings, recommended repairs, and costs. Not an open-ended “we’ll see.” After the repair, a short report with readings, photos where helpful, and notes on system condition allows you to decide on next steps. I encourage homeowners to ask for the old parts if practical. Most techs are happy to show you a swollen capacitor, a charred contactor, or a clogged trap. It builds trust and helps you spot issues next time.

Warranty terms matter too. Many companies back labor for 30 to 90 days and parts based on manufacturer warranty, often 1 to 5 years for OEM components. Clarify if a diagnostic fee applies again if the same symptom returns within the warranty window. Good shops are upfront, and they track your system history so they do not chase the same ghost twice.

Preventative steps that keep repairs small

Maintenance and repair live side by side. Skipping maintenance usually turns small problems into large ones. A conscientious ac maintenance services visit focuses on airflow, cleanliness, and baseline numbers. Changing filters on schedule sounds mundane until you measure the static pressure drop across a clogged filter rack. Cleaning outdoor coils with the right solution and low pressure restores heat transfer and reduces compressor stress. Straightening crushed fins is not just cosmetic. It lowers head pressure and amps.

Taking baseline readings each season is insurance. Record superheat, subcool, temperature splits, static pressure, and compressor amperage. Over time, trends show where a system is headed. A blower motor drawing 20 percent more current than last season is a canary in the mine. Catch it before it fails on a holiday weekend.

Water management is another unsung hero. Flush the condensate drain, verify traps are properly configured, and test the float switch. Add an overflow pan alarm if the air handler is in the attic. It is difficult to oversell the cost-benefit on that device. For high-efficiency furnaces, clean the condensate trap and inspect the secondary heat exchanger side for debris. Gurgling noises and pressure switch errors are often drainage, not airflow.

When “affordable ac repair” is not the cheapest option

People search for affordable ac repair because no one budgets for breakdowns. Price matters. But the cheapest fix today can cost more later. Here is a common scenario. A six-year-old unit is low on refrigerant. A top-off makes it cool again, and it is the least expensive approach. Without a leak check, you will be paying for refrigerant again, and the compressor is operating in a borderline condition. A better path finds and repairs the leak. If the coil is the culprit and out of warranty, you face a larger bill. This is when a pro should walk you through options, including part replacement versus system replacement, with numbers and context.

Lifetime cost includes energy, repairs, and expected lifespan. I have replaced blower motors every other year on a system that had a duct problem and an oversized condenser. Fixing the duct restriction and resetting blower speeds would have saved years of frustration. The “repair” was not the motor; it was the static pressure.

Emergency ac repair and what changes after hours

Emergency ac repair has a different tempo. The goal is to stabilize conditions fast. On a 95-degree night with a family at risk of heat stress, a tech may install a hard-start kit temporarily to get a tight compressor running, then schedule a follow-up to evaluate the true cause in daylight. They might bypass a faulty thermostat to force cooling in the short term or add a condensate pump to keep the air handler from tripping on a full pan.

The trade-off with after-hours work is parts availability and diagnostic depth. The best shops stock common capacitors, contactors, fan motors, ignitors, flame sensors, pressure switches, and a range of universal boards. Still, some OEM parts need to come from a distributor in the morning. Expect open communication on what is temporary and what will be permanent, and expect transparent pricing that reflects the urgency while staying fair.

The parts that fail most, and what that teaches

Certain components fail predictably under certain conditions. Capacitance drifts downward with heat and time, so weak capacitors peak in late summer. Contactor points pit from arcing and dust, so outdoor electrical compartments benefit from periodic cleaning and inspection. ECM blower motors do not like voltage spikes or poor grounding. Surge protection is cheap insurance, especially in storm-prone regions.

Refrigerant leaks concentrate at flare connections, rubbing points on line sets where they pass through frames, and on coils near the U-bends. If a system had line set insulation chewed up by pests or UV, I almost always find stress points. Fixing the insulation and strapping the lines properly is part of a real repair.

Drain problems flare up after construction or renovations. Drywall dust and sawdust clog traps quickly. If you had work done in the home, even months ago, mention it. A tech who asks about recent projects is usually a tech who catches this early.

When to repair, when to replace

Customers ask this often, and the answer is more nuanced than a formula. Age is a factor, but not the only one. I look at system age, repair history, refrigerant type, efficiency, and the condition of the duct system.

Systems using R-22 are end-of-line. Refrigerant is scarce and expensive, and repairs quickly cross into false economy. For R-410A systems in good condition, even at 12 to 15 years old, a targeted repair can make sense if the compressor and coils test healthy. If the repair involves a major component, like an evaporator coil or compressor, I price both the repair and a replacement option, then talk through energy savings, utility rebates, and comfort features.

Duct condition is a swing vote. Replacing the box without fixing leaks, mastic sealing, and sizing issues wastes the investment. Sometimes the best money you spend is on duct sealing and return improvements, paired with modest repairs, rather than a shiny new condenser fighting the same old restrictions.

How pros diagnose quickly without cutting corners

Speed and accuracy are not enemies. Pattern recognition helps, but measurement anchors it. For cooling, I want to see:

    Filter condition and static pressure baseline at the start, then after any airflow corrections. Superheat and subcool readings, along with indoor and outdoor wet-bulb and dry-bulb temperatures.

That is one of the two lists in this article by design, because clarity matters here. Those numbers let a tech confirm or reject hypotheses fast. On heating, capturing temperature rise, inducer and blower amperage, gas pressure, and combustion analysis gives the same clarity.

Anecdotally, I have fixed “mystery” intermittent lockouts by finding a marginal low-voltage connection outside where sprinkler overspray soaked a wire nut. The diagnostic process caught it because I took voltage readings under load at the board, not just at the thermostat. The more thorough the initial readings, the fewer callbacks.

What a fair price looks like

Regional labor rates vary. A diagnostic visit can range from 80 to 180 dollars in many markets, with repairs adding parts and labor. Emergency calls cost more, often 1.5 times regular labor. Flat-rate pricing is common and can be consumer-friendly if the scope is clearly defined. If a tech can quote a capacitor replacement instantly but hesitates when you ask about what else they checked, you might not be getting a full picture.

Affordable ac repair is not only about the immediate bill. Ask how the repair affects efficiency and lifespan. A correctly charged system can drop energy use by 5 to 15 percent compared to a system running low or overcharged. Cleaning a clogged outdoor coil can shave amperage immediately, which you can verify on the meter.

Small homeowner habits that prevent big calls

You do not need to be a tech to keep your system out of trouble. Replace filters on schedule, not by feel. Most 1-inch filters need monthly checks in peak season, while 4 to 5-inch media filters can go 3 to 6 months depending on dust and pets. Keep outdoor units clear of vegetation within at least 18 to 24 inches. Gently hose off cottonwood and debris on the coil fins from the outside inward, with the unit off, to avoid embedding dirt further.

Keep supply and return grilles unblocked. A couch or rug over a return starves a system. If you see ice on the refrigerant lines, shut the system off at the thermostat and run the fan only to thaw, then call for service. If the condensate overflow switch trips, do not bypass it. That switch may be the only thing between you and a water-damaged ceiling.

The HVAC maintenance service you actually want

A maintenance visit should feel like a health check, not a sales pitch. Expect coil inspection and cleaning as needed, static pressure measurement, blower wheel inspection, electrical tightening and testing, refrigerant performance verification through superheat and subcool calculations, drain cleaning, thermostat calibration checks, and for gas systems, combustion analysis with documented readings. If you receive only a filter swap and a cursory look, that is not maintenance.

Seasonal timing matters. For cooling, schedule before heat waves. For heating, before the first cold snap. In practice, spring and fall sell out fast, so consider booking at the end of the prior season. Membership plans can be worth it if they guarantee response times during peak demand and include meaningful work, not just front-of-line privileges.

When DIY makes sense, and when it does not

There is plenty you can do safely: filters, keeping the outdoor unit clear, gentle coil rinsing, replacing thermostat batteries, checking that the condensate line is draining. Beyond that, risks climb. Refrigerant handling requires certification, and guessing at a charge without measuring superheat or subcool is a shortcut to compressor damage. Working inside a furnace or electrical compartments without the right meter and knowledge invites shocks and miswires. If you are comfortable with basic checks, great. For anything deeper, call a pro.
